1979 Renault 20 vs. 2011 Honda Accord

To start off, 2011 Honda Accord is newer by 32 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1979 Renault 20.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1979 Renault 20 would be higher. At 2,400 cc (4 cylinders), 2011 Honda Accord is equipped with a bigger engine.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2011 Honda Accord weights approximately 312 kg more than 1979 Renault 20.

Both vehicles are front wheel drive (FWD). Which offers better traction when its slippery than rear wheel drive vehicles.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. 2011 Honda Accord has automatic transmission and 1979 Renault 20 has manual transmission. 1979 Renault 20 will offer better control over acceleration and deceleration in addition to better fuel efficiency overall. 2011 Honda Accord will be easier to drive especially in heavy traffic.
